Understanding Compression Bandages and Their Purpose

Compression bandages serve a crucial purpose in injury management. They are designed to apply controlled pressure on an injury, which helps reduce swelling and pain. The consistent pressure encourages blood circulation and minimizes fluid buildup in the affected area. This is especially useful for sprains, strains, and post-surgical recovery.

When using a compression bandage, it’s essential to wrap it correctly. Start at the farthest point from the heart and work your way up. The bandage should be snug but not too tight. Check for numbness or excessive swelling. If these occur, loosen the bandage. Finding the right balance with pressure can take practice.

Staying active after your injury can aid recovery. Gentle movements promote blood flow. However, avoid high-impact activities that can worsen your condition. Remember, recovery is a gradual process. Listening to your body is key. Seek advice from a healthcare professional if unsure about the right compression method.

Pain Relief Mechanisms Associated with Compression Bandages

Compression bandages are commonly used for injury management. They provide support and reduce swelling. The pressure from the bandage helps to limit the space where fluid can accumulate. This simple mechanism plays a crucial role in pain relief.

When applied correctly, a compression bandage can improve circulation in the affected area. Enhanced blood flow helps to deliver oxygen and nutrients. This can speed up the healing process and reduce inflammation. Moreover, the consistent pressure can help soothe the surrounding nerves, leading to pain relief. Pain can be alleviated through these multiple pathways, suggesting that compression bandages have a multifaceted approach.

It's essential to apply the bandage properly. If it’s too tight, it can cause numbness or even more pain. Users must monitor their symptoms. Adjusting the tightness should not be overlooked. Compression bandages can be effective, but they require care and attention to detail to be truly beneficial.

Proper Techniques for Applying Compression Bandages

Applying compression bandages correctly is crucial for effectively reducing swelling and pain. Understanding the anatomy of the affected area helps. Before starting, ensure the area is clean and dry. Use a roll of bandage that is wide enough to cover the injury without leaving gaps.

Begin wrapping the bandage from the furthest point from the heart. Overlap each layer by half the width of the bandage. This creates even pressure. It’s important not to wrap too tightly, as this can cause discomfort or restrict blood flow. Pay attention to any signs of numbness or increased pain. If these occur, it's okay to loosen the bandage.

In some cases, it's easy to make mistakes. For instance, failing to secure the end of the bandage can lead to it unraveling. It's essential to secure the bandage properly, using clips or tape. Assessing the effectiveness frequently is vital. If swelling persists, re-evaluate your wrapping technique. Getting it right may take practice, but the benefit of reducing swelling and pain makes it worthwhile.
